MATLAB信号频谱分析FFT详解 📈✨
发布时间:2025-04-03 02:09:04来源:
导读 在信号处理领域,FFT(快速傅里叶变换)是分析信号频率成分的重要工具。它能将时域信号转换为频域表示,帮助我们理解信号的频率特性。那么...
在信号处理领域,FFT(快速傅里叶变换)是分析信号频率成分的重要工具。它能将时域信号转换为频域表示,帮助我们理解信号的频率特性。那么,如何通过FFT频谱图读懂信号的秘密呢?👀
首先,打开MATLAB,导入你的信号数据,使用`fft()`函数进行计算。得到的结果是一个复数数组,其中包含了不同频率下的幅值和相位信息。为了更直观地观察,可以绘制幅频特性图,即频率-幅值的关系。这时你会发现横轴代表频率,纵轴显示幅值,峰值位置对应主要的频率成分。🔍📈
其次,别忘了设置合适的采样率和频率分辨率!如果频率分辨率不够高,可能会导致高频分量被忽略。此外,注意频谱的对称性——对于实信号,正负频率是对称的,只关注一半即可。💡
最后,结合实际应用场景,比如滤波设计或故障诊断,灵活运用FFT分析结果。掌握FFT频谱图的解读能力,让你在信号处理中更加得心应手!🎉
版权声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,多谢。